From e3d6c9733488b531b707849b256e4824a8ee3645 Mon Sep 17 00:00:00 2001 From: Jens Petersen Date: Jan 30 2023 15:48:23 +0000 Subject: hadrian: put ghc manpage in the right place --- diff --git a/ghc.spec b/ghc.spec index 679fe27..f9192f5 100644 --- a/ghc.spec +++ b/ghc.spec @@ -692,6 +692,11 @@ sh %{gen_contents_index} --intree --verbose cd .. %endif +mkdir -p %{buildroot}%{_mandir}/man1 +install -p -m 0644 %{SOURCE5} %{buildroot}%{_mandir}/man1/ghc-pkg.1 +install -p -m 0644 %{SOURCE6} %{buildroot}%{_mandir}/man1/haddock.1 +install -p -m 0644 %{SOURCE7} %{buildroot}%{_mandir}/man1/runghc.1 + %if %{with hadrian} %if %{with haddock} rm %{buildroot}%{_pkgdocdir}/archives/libraries.html.tar.xz @@ -699,6 +704,7 @@ rm %{buildroot}%{_pkgdocdir}/archives/libraries.html.tar.xz %if %{with manual} rm %{buildroot}%{_pkgdocdir}/archives/Haddock.html.tar.xz rm %{buildroot}%{_pkgdocdir}/archives/users_guide.html.tar.xz +mv %{buildroot}%{ghc_html_dir}/users_guide/build-man/ghc.1 %{buildroot}%{_mandir}/man1/ %endif %endif @@ -707,11 +713,6 @@ rm %{buildroot}%{_pkgdocdir}/archives/users_guide.html.tar.xz find %{buildroot}%{ghc_html_libraries_dir} -name LICENSE -exec rm '{}' ';' %endif -mkdir -p %{buildroot}%{_mandir}/man1 -install -p -m 0644 %{SOURCE5} %{buildroot}%{_mandir}/man1/ghc-pkg.1 -install -p -m 0644 %{SOURCE6} %{buildroot}%{_mandir}/man1/haddock.1 -install -p -m 0644 %{SOURCE7} %{buildroot}%{_mandir}/man1/runghc.1 - %ifarch armv7hl export RPM_BUILD_NCPUS=1 %endif